Frequently Asked Questions

  • What are the best places to stay in Santander?

    Travelers often stay around the city center for easy access to markets, cafés, and museums, or choose the Sardinero area, known for beaches and relaxed vibes. Both neighborhoods have a variety of accommodations to fit different travel styles.

  • What are the best things to do in Santander with kids?

    Families explore the Magdalena Peninsula, spend time at local beaches, or visit the maritime museum for interactive exhibits. Parks around the city and marine-themed attractions are frequently suggested for children.

  • What are some of the best things to do in Santander?

    Explore the Magdalena Peninsula, wander around the historic center, and visit the Centro Botín for contemporary art. Beaches, seafood restaurants, and waterfront walks are frequently suggested for first-time visitors.

  • How is the weather in Santander?

    Santander has moderate coastal weather, with winter temperatures around 44-57°F (7-14°C) and summer days reaching 62-76°F (17-25°C). Rain is frequent from late autumn to early spring, so a light jacket and umbrella are helpful year-round.

  • What are the best places to visit in Santander?

    The Magdalena Peninsula, the Cathedral, and Centro Botín are some of Santander’s most popular sights. Many visitors also explore local beaches and enjoy walks along the promenade.

  • What are some hiking trails in Santander?

    Explore trails on the Magdalena Peninsula or walk the coastal paths around Mataleñas Park for scenic ocean views. These routes mix natural landscapes with city proximity and are frequently suggested for visitors.

  • What are some family activities we can do in Santander?

    Families can enjoy the mini-zoo at the Magdalena Peninsula, visit science or maritime museums, and explore local playgrounds. Seasonal beach time and boat rides around the bay are also popular with children.

  • What are some of the best day trip ideas from Santander?

    Many travelers choose to explore nearby mountain villages, visit prehistoric caves with ancient art, or relax at beaches in coastal towns around Cantabria. Nature parks and regional markets also draw frequent interest.

  • Are there any pet friendly accommodations available in Santander?

    Santander has pet-friendly stays in various neighborhoods, especially around the city center and beachfront areas. Some parks and promenades welcome dogs, making it easier to explore the city with a pet.

  • What are some local tips for visiting Santander?

    Locals suggest sampling fresh seafood at neighborhood bars, wearing comfortable shoes for walking hilly streets, and bringing a light rain jacket as the weather can be changeable. Try visiting the market early for locally sourced foods.

  • What is Santander known for?

    Santander is known for its sandy urban beaches, the Magdalena Peninsula, and a vibrant seafood dining scene. The city also has a rich maritime history and a mix of traditional and contemporary culture.

  • What are the best hidden gems to explore in Santander?

    Explore quiet coves near Mataleñas Park, tucked-away alleyways in the city center, or local art spaces that highlight regional creativity. The Mercado de la Esperanza draws food lovers looking for authentic market experiences.

  • What are the best foods to try in Santander?

    Local highlights often include anchovies from Cantabria, creamy sobao pastries, and fresh seafood dishes like rabas. Traditional stews and locally made cheeses are also frequently suggested.

  • What should I bring for a trip to Santander?

    Pack breathable clothing for warmer months, layers for cooler days, and a rain jacket due to frequent showers. Comfortable walking shoes are helpful for exploring hilly streets and coastal paths.

  • What is the nightlife in Santander like?

    Santander has a mix of relaxed beach bars, music venues, and lively cafés in neighborhoods like the city center and El Sardinero. Nightlife is known for casual gatherings, live performances, and late-night tapas spots.

  • What are the most popular events or festivals in Santander?

    The city’s summer week, Semana Grande, is widely celebrated with music and cultural activities. Santander Music Festival and events centered around the bay are frequently suggested annual highlights.

  • Are there family friendly vacation rentals in Santander?

    Many vacation rentals in Santander welcome families, with options featuring extra space and kitchens, especially in areas around the beaches and city center. Local hosts often share tips for child-friendly activities nearby.

  • When is the best time to visit Santander?

    Late spring through early autumn is often recommended for milder temperatures, clearer skies, and vibrant local festivals. Summer brings pleasant weather for beach outings and outdoor dining.
